Appomattox, VA, offers a cost of living that is notably lower than the nationwide average. The overall cost of living index for Appomattox stands at 88, which is 12% below the national benchmark of 100. This makes Appomattox a more affordable place for housing, groceries, utilities, transportation, healthcare, and miscellaneous expenses.
